Woman stabs 57-year-old man in Harlingen

A 31-year-old woman was arrested Friday night after she stabbed a man.

Harlingen Police responded to a disturbance call around 10:30 p.m.

When they got to a home on the 3100 block of Lamb St., they found a man stabbed three times.

The victim was allegedly stabbed in his torso by Lydia Carolina Partain.

Partain was taken into custody and is awaiting arraignment.

She faces Aggravated Assault with a Deadly Weapon charges.

The 57-year-old man was taken to the hospital for his wounds.

His condition remains unknown at this time.
